Kentucky’s first Vans store opening this week
It might get a little easier for Kentuckians to get Twitter-famous this week.
Vans: Off the Wall opens Thursday in the Outlet Shoppes of the Bluegrass in Simpsonville.
The outlet store makes it the only brick-and-mortar Vans in the state, according to the company’s website. Other stores in Kentucky are authorized to sell Vans products.
Vans, famous for skateboarding apparel and shoes, was founded 50 years ago in Southern California. A tweet that a Southern California teen sent about his friend Daniel’s choice of Vans footwear went viral last month. The tweet features a 30-second video of Daniel Lara, a high school student in California and his new Vans shoes.

Outlet Shoppes general manager Dan Davilla said in a news release that the addition of Vans would help attract “today’s youth market.”
The store will be near the recently opened Johnny Rockets.
